WebJul 31, 2024 · 5 Culturally Responsive Teaching Strategies for Educators. 1. Activate students’ prior knowledge. Students are not blank slates, Childers-McKee says; they enter the classroom with diverse experiences. WebJun 27, 2024 · Learning materials can also add important structure to lesson planning and the delivery of instruction. Particularly in lower grades, learning materials act as a guide for both the teacher and student in that they offer a valuable routine.
